
Summary
The Tesat ConLCT80 is a laser communication terminal designed for low earth orbit (LEO) broadband satellites. It has a bidirectional channel data rate of 10 Gbps and beaconless pointing acquisition and tracking. Depending on the data rate it consumes power between 60 Watts to 80 Watts. The product weighs 15 kgs and has a service lifetime of five years.
Applications
Suitable for smallsat LEO to ground laser communication range.
Key features
- Laser communication terminal optimized for 60cm aperture optical ground station with uplink beacon, 1550nm IM DD technology, 10min communication time/ground station pass
- Integrated terminal controller for autonomous terminal operation; integrated mass memory; uplink TC channel from optical ground station
- Reference implementation for CCSDS standard
